    Broken Art is the most professional, artistic, wonderful tattoo shop! Dont go anywhere else. Broken Art is great for first timers, heck, I would take my beautiful mother here to get a tattoo. Once you walk into the basement lair that is Broken Art, you can sense that everyone is an artist and considers tattoos as your personal artistic expression. Lets just say I have done all the research for you, been to other tattoo shops, and Broken Art runs circles around the other places... Broken Art is it... PERIOD! Jeremy Swan has tattooed a huge back piece on me, and we are working on my left arms sleeve. Justin Cox has brought life to some of my rather old and faded foot tatttoos, thank god. Derik is Swans apprentice, and let me tell you... people are lining up and getting amazing tattoos... Two years into the game, Derik far surpasses most Los Angeles tattoo artist. YES, I said that. He rocks the old school traditional with amazing creative twists. The cherry on the cake at Broken Art is YUSHI, one name. Just off the plane from Korea, Yushi is our equivalent of a rock star over in Japan and Korea. His traditional Japanese IS traditional Japanese. do you get it now... You must look no further. Broken Art the best tattoo shop in Los Angeles.
